The reason I even dared cook this in the first place, is that it only has 5 ingredients. Yep, 5. I got the recipe out of a cook book called "52 recipes for the nervous cook and missionaries". I got it a deseret book for like 5 bucks, and the recipes are definitely more on my level. Ok...so I know you are wondering...here are the ingredients..



  • Chicken
  • spaghetti sauce
  • angel hair
  • parmesan cheese
  • mozzarella cheese

Yep, that's it! Well, if you don't count all the spices I throw in. The trick is to cook the chicken seperately before you throw it in with all the rest of the stuff. Cook it, season it like crazy with italian seasoning and pepper, and cut it into medium pieces. That will make it so it's not so dry. Use angel hair instead of spaghetti, it's a heck of a lot better. Put the noodles mixed with half of the sauce into a pan first. Layer it with both cheeses. Then put the cooked seasoned chicken pieces in over it. Put more spaghetti and sauce and cheese over that, and mix it all up good. Bake it till the cheese melts. And voila! That's it!!
